I recently entered a thread on here about the VanDyke broadheads I had previously purchased from an online store (other than Radical Archery) not completely screwing in down to my inserts. I spoke with RadSav about it, and the next day his partner Darren came to my restaurant in Tacoma. I must say that RadSav, Darren, and Radical Archery took care of me big time. It turns out the inserts that were put in for a better FOC was the problem. A quick audible from Derrick, and I'm back in business. I can't say enough good things about this company right now. Thank you Radical Archery, thank you.
